Halbach Baconfest Part II – Taste Test

For the big bacon taste test, we had 5 competitors:

  1. Nueske’s – Applewood smoked, pepper coated
  2. Dreymiller and Kray – Hickory smoked
  3. Prairie Grove Farms – Applewood smoked, uncured
  4. Trader Joe’s – Apple smoked, uncured
  5. Moore Family Farm – Smoked and cured

I should add that the Moore Family Farm is not available in stores. We are part of a buying group that buys meat and eggs from a farm downstate. We’ve been out to visit the farm a few times, so I’ve probably actually met the pigs that went into that bacon!

So here is the list of our rankings, with the grand prize winners at the end. The winner may surprise you!

Shane:

Brand Type Rating (1-10) Comments
Nueske’s Applewood smoked, pepper coated 6 Dark edges due to pepper, not as salty, less flavor than I expected, little bit of pepper after-burn
Dreymiller and Kray Hickory smoked 7 wider strips, good texture, a little fattier, nice to have non-applewood, very salty
Prairie Grove Farms Applewood smoked, uncured 8 salty, nice appearance, very good flavor
Trader Joe’s Apple smoked, uncured 8 straightest, flattest bacon, sort of factory looking, salty, good flavor, lean
Moore Family Farm Smoked and cured 4 fattier, sort of chewy, not very seasoned or salty, most authentically pork tasting, maybe good for soup

Nathan:

Brand Type Rating (1-10) Comments
Nueske’s Applewood smoked, pepper coated 7 The after taste is where all the flavor is, most smokey flavor
Dreymiller and Kray Hickory smoked 8 Hickory: tasted a little more flavorful because of the fat
Prairie Grove Farms Applewood smoked, uncured 8 Seasoned well can’t taste the smokiness or apple wood.
Trader Joe’s Apple smoked, uncured 7 Lean, flat, good flavor – hint of apple wood but not too strong
Moore Family Farm Smoked and cured 5 Thicker cut, more fat, so not as crisp, but not as flavorful

Sara:

Brand Type Rating (1-10) Comments
Nueske’s Applewood smoked, pepper coated 7 light and peppery, good to try, but wouldn’t choose on a regular basis
Dreymiller and Kray Hickory smoked 6 a little saltier, would be a good topping for pizza
Prairie Grove Farms Applewood smoked, uncured 8 very salty but flavor is great – also pretty flat (think BLTs)
Trader Joe’s Apple smoked, uncured 10 good pig flavor, nice flat slice
Moore Family Farm Smoked and cured 4 stringy and chewy, flaovr is “piggy” but texture unappealing

Results:

Brand Average Rating
Trader Joe’s 8 1/3
Prairie Grove Farms 8
Dreymiller and Kray 7
Nueske’s 6 2/3
Moore Family Farm 4 1/3

I was downright stunned that the Trader Joe’s one won. First off, it was the least exotic of the bunch. Second off, it was one of the cheapest (I can’t remember if it was cheaper than Moore Family Farm or not). Third off, it was probably the least impressive looking. After these results are in, I have discovered that this particular kind of bacon from Trader Joe’s has a big following. So really, this was a fantastic result, because this is the one kind of bacon that we might reasonably buy on a regular basis.

The other interesting thing was that the Prairie Grove brand came in second. This was the one that was the “healthiest”. Of course it’s still bacon, but it was hormone free, antibiotic free, etc. So even though you still have to feel bad about it, I guess you don’t have to feel AS bad about it.
